Recipes are split between main courses, main course components, side dishes, soups and desserts, meaning that access to a kitchen is required for many of the recipes. The Author assumes that the user has access to basic kitchen equipment, such as a refrigerator, a sieve or colander, sharp knives, a stove, a baking tin, a frying pan and saucepans, although many of the recipes do not require any further equipment. I found the formula is pretty simple, follow your usual cake recipe and then air fry in a preheated air fryer for 30 minutes at 150C.
